#Antec 1200 (2009-06-20) I have built countless systems and this is the best case i have encountered to date. It is a fantastic case with loads of room and great cooling ability. You can also hide all the wiring behind the motherboard and backpanel which greatly improves the look and cooling properties of your system. It is well worth the extra cash outlay. i would rate this case as 100%

#Superb Gaming Case (2008-10-05) I spent a long time looking for a case which could hold my new GeForce GTX 280 graphics card and keep my rig running cool at the same time. This case fits the bill perfectly. It is very simple to install all the parts, with a great back plate behind the motherboard tray to keep all your excess wiring in place. It feature 3 fans in the front, 2 in the back and a HUGE one on the top, you also have the option of buying 2 extra for the sides.
